What is Preventive Care?
Preventive care includes medical services that aim to detect and stop diseases before they become serious. This includes:
- Routine physical exams
- Vaccinations
- Screenings for conditions like diabetes, heart disease, and cancer
- Lifestyle counseling for diet, exercise, and quitting smoking
These proactive measures help you stay healthier, longer—and often reduce healthcare costs in the long run.
The Life-Saving Benefits of Preventive Care
1. Early Detection of Serious Diseases
Catching conditions like cancer, high blood pressure, or diabetes early makes them far easier to treat. For example:
- Breast cancer detected early has a 90%+ survival rate.
- High blood pressure can be managed before it leads to heart attacks or strokes.
- Type 2 diabetes can be reversed in its early stages with proper diet and activity.
2. Better Management of Chronic Illness
If you’re already dealing with conditions like asthma, heart disease, or thyroid issues, regular monitoring helps control symptoms and prevent flare-ups.
3. Lower Medical Costs Over Time
While check-ups may seem like an added expense, they can help avoid costly emergency treatments, hospital stays, or surgeries in the future.
4. Longer, Healthier Life
Preventive care promotes healthier lifestyle choices. Counseling on nutrition, mental health, and exercise can significantly improve your quality of life.
How to Get Started with Preventive Care
- Schedule a comprehensive annual check-up.
- Discuss your personal and family health history.
- Follow through with recommended screenings and lab tests.
- Adopt a healthier lifestyle with the help of your provider.
